riscv: hwcap: change ELF_HWCAP to a function

Using a function is flexible to represent ELF_HWCAP. So the kernel may
encode hwcap reflecting supported hardware features just at the moment of
the start of each program.

This will be helpful when we introduce prctl/sysctl interface to control
per-process availability of Vector extension in following patches.
Programs started with V disabled should see V masked off in theirs
ELF_HWCAP.
